The Clinical Support Training Specialist is responsible for designing, developing, and updating interactive eLearning modules to enhance clinical training. This role involves collaboration with clinical professionals, coordination of virtual training sessions, administration of the Learning Management System (LMS), and continuous evaluation and improvement of training effectiveness.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following:

Instructional Design & Content Development

The Clinical Support Training Specialist will design, develop, and update interactive eLearning modules using instructional design best practices and adult learning principles. This includes enhancing existing content and training into engaging, effective digital formats and ensuring that training materials reflect current clinical practices, company policies, and regulatory standards.

Collaboration & Subject Matter Expertise

The specialist will work closely with Clinical Nurse Educators, pharmacy leaders, and other subject matter experts to assess training needs and gather accurate, relevant content. They will participate in planning meetings to align training initiatives with clinical goals and organizational strategy, and facilitate collaborative reviews of training materials to ensure clinical accuracy and relevance.

Virtual Training Coordination

The Clinical Support Training Specialist will schedule, coordinate, and provide logistical support for virtual in-services, webinars, and live training sessions. They will support facilitators and learners during live sessions to ensure smooth technical operation and participant engagement, and maintain a calendar of upcoming training sessions while communicating logistics to appropriate teams.

LMS Administration & Compliance Monitoring

The specialist will upload and manage eLearning content, learning paths, and user access in the Learning Management System (LMS). They will track participation and training completions, generating reports to support compliance with accreditation and regulatory requirements, and maintain accurate records for audits and internal reviews.

Evaluation & Continuous Improvement

They will develop and administer training assessments and surveys to evaluate the effectiveness of learning experiences, analyze feedback and performance data to recommend and implement improvements, and stay informed on trends in eLearning, healthcare training, and regulatory changes to continuously evolve the training program.
